Electrostatic Discharge (ESD) is the sudden and momentary release of electric current that results from a voltage difference between two physically connected points. Power over Ethernet (POE) applications enable standard Ethernet cables to carry both data and power to remote devices, greatly simplifying the networked system. POE reduces the number of cables needed to connect networked devices and enables systems to access locations where power is not readily.
